Attempting to write a guide in very simple english explaining the whys and wherefores of EFL readings in the context of TT systems.

The OSG advises the max EFLI outside the consumer's installation for TT is 21 ohms, excluding the consumer's earth electrode.

How is this best translated? I'm coming unstuck trying to make this simple!!

p11 of osg is an introduction to the guide and does not state any regs,(apart from 313-01-01), it only states the installations to which the guide applies.
Try chapter 54 of regs book p111, Earthing arrangements and protective conductors, and 413-02-18 p49 for Ra calculation for tt systems.
Not sure why you would want to write a guide to tt earthing, but hope that helps.

No, I know that page of the OSG does not mention any regs, just trying to get a handle on what the statement on that page actually means.

I'm writing a guide to EFL readings expected on TT systems for the engineers that work for my company.
 
As I understand it, it is making a clear restriction that the OSG information (which is a cut down version of the full regs) is based on an assumed best possibly achievable Ze of 21 Ohms on a TT system. For example with the best possible earth spike conditions the resistance from there to the DNO spike would be at worst no higher than 21 Ohms, which is why they say Excluding the spike.
They have rules on how much distance they can travel before spiking their earth to ground and also rules on how they achieve the best earthing into the ground.
